Overview
- Petro-Perú’s board named Gustavo Adolfo Villa Mora acting general manager by Board Agreement No. 142-2025-PP and notified the securities regulator (SMV).
- Villa, previously operations manager at the Talara refinery, takes over from José Manuel Rodríguez Haya, who had been serving in an interim capacity since October 24.
- Two earlier bids failed this week: Arturo Rodríguez’s candidacy was withdrawn due to an ongoing judicial investigation, and Iván Montoya was rejected for not meeting Fonafe’s executive profile requirements.
- All three candidates considered were proposed by a circle close to former general manager Óscar Vera, according to reporting that describes his continued influence inside the company.
- Sources also report concerns that the outgoing network seeks to stall the Talara refinery’s planned forensic audit, while a MEF team is said to be working with the General Shareholders’ Meeting on potential reorganization steps.
